43/dts-v1/;
44#include "sun4i-a10.dtsi"
45#include "sunxi-common-regulators.dtsi"
46#include <dt-bindings/gpio/gpio.h>
47#include <dt-bindings/input/input.h>
48#include <dt-bindings/interrupt-controller/irq.h>
49#include <dt-bindings/pwm/pwm.h>
50
51/ {
52 model = "Point of View Protab2-IPS9";
53 compatible = "pov,protab2-ips9", "allwinner,sun4i-a10";
54
55 aliases {
56 serial0 = &uart0;
57 };
58
59 backlight: backlight {
60 compatible = "pwm-backlight";
61 pwms = <&pwm 0 50000 PWM_POLARITY_INVERTED>;
62 brightness-levels = <0 10 20 30 40 50 60 70 80 90 100>;
63 default-brightness-level = <8>;
64 enable-gpios = <&pio 7 7 GPIO_ACTIVE_HIGH>; /* PH7 */
65 power-supply = <®_vcc3v3>;
66 };
67
68 chosen {
69 stdout-path = "serial0:115200n8";
70 };
71};
72
73&codec {
74 allwinner,pa-gpios = <&pio 7 15 GPIO_ACTIVE_HIGH>; /* PH15 */
75 status = "okay";
76};
77
78&cpu0 {
79 cpu-supply = <®_dcdc2>;
80};
81
82&ehci0 {
83 status = "okay";
84};
85
86&i2c0 {
87 status = "okay";
88
89 axp209: pmic@34 {
90 reg = <0x34>;
91 interrupts = <0>;
92 };
93};
94
95#include "axp209.dtsi"
96
97&i2c1 {
98 /* pull-ups and devices require AXP209 LDO3 */
99 status = "failed";
100};
101
102&i2c2 {
103 status = "okay";
104
105 touchscreen@5c {
106 compatible = "pixcir,pixcir_tangoc";
107 reg = <0x5c>;
108 interrupt-parent = <&pio>;
109 interrupts = <7 21 IRQ_TYPE_EDGE_FALLING>; /* EINT21 (PH21) */
110 attb-gpio = <&pio 7 21 GPIO_ACTIVE_HIGH>; /* PH21 */
111 enable-gpios = <&pio 0 5 GPIO_ACTIVE_LOW>;
112 wake-gpios = <&pio 1 13 GPIO_ACTIVE_LOW>;
113 touchscreen-size-x = <1024>;
114 touchscreen-size-y = <768>;
115 touchscreen-inverted-x;
116 touchscreen-inverted-y;
117 };
118};
119
120&lradc {
121 vref-supply = <®_ldo2>;
122 status = "okay";
123
124 button-400 {
125 label = "Volume Up";
126 linux,code = <KEY_VOLUMEUP>;
127 channel = <0>;
128 voltage = <400000>;
129 };
130
131 button-800 {
132 label = "Volume Down";
133 linux,code = <KEY_VOLUMEDOWN>;
134 channel = <0>;
135 voltage = <800000>;
136 };
137};
138
139&mmc0 {
140 vmmc-supply = <®_vcc3v3>;
141 bus-width = <4>;
142 cd-gpios = <&pio 7 1 GPIO_ACTIVE_LOW>; /* PH1 */
143 status = "okay";
144};
145
146&otg_sram {
147 status = "okay";
148};
149
150&pwm {
151 pinctrl-names = "default";
152 pinctrl-0 = <&pwm0_pin>;
153 status = "okay";
154};
155
156®_dcdc2 {
157 regulator-always-on;
158 regulator-min-microvolt = <1000000>;
159 regulator-max-microvolt = <1400000>;
160 regulator-name = "vdd-cpu";
161};
162
163®_dcdc3 {
164 regulator-always-on;
165 regulator-min-microvolt = <1250000>;
166 regulator-max-microvolt = <1250000>;
167 regulator-name = "vdd-int-dll";
168};
169
170®_ldo1 {
171 regulator-name = "vdd-rtc";
172};
173
174®_ldo2 {
175 regulator-always-on;
176 regulator-min-microvolt = <3000000>;
177 regulator-max-microvolt = <3000000>;
178 regulator-name = "avcc";
179};
180
181®_usb0_vbus {
182 status = "okay";
183};
184
185®_usb1_vbus {
186 status = "okay";
187};
188
189&uart0 {
190 pinctrl-names = "default";
191 pinctrl-0 = <&uart0_pb_pins>;
192 status = "okay";
193};
194
195&usb_otg {
196 dr_mode = "otg";
197 status = "okay";
198};
199
200&usbphy {
201 usb0_id_det-gpios = <&pio 7 4 (GPIO_ACTIVE_HIGH | GPIO_PULL_UP)>; /* PH4 */
202 usb0_vbus_det-gpios = <&pio 7 5 (GPIO_ACTIVE_HIGH | GPIO_PULL_DOWN)>; /* PH5 */
203 usb0_vbus-supply = <®_usb0_vbus>;
204 usb1_vbus-supply = <®_usb1_vbus>;
205 status = "okay";
206};
